Beeceptor is an API mocking and testing tool that assists developers in simulating endpoints effortlessly without delays. Suitable for development and testing processes, it ensures seamless API design and deployment.
Designed for developers and testers, Beeceptor allows easy mock server creation with custom logic and real-time monitoring. It provides a platform for testing API responses and workflows without impacting live systems. Its simplicity and efficiency help streamline API development, reducing common bottlenecks in the process. A valuable resource for debugging and improving front-end and back-end communication, it adapts well to different testing requirements.

Oracle API Platform Cloud Service enables companies to thrive in the digital economy by comprehensively managing the full API lifecycle from design and standardization to documenting, publishing, testing and managing APIs. These tools provide API developers, managers, and users an end-to-end platform for designing, prototyping. Through the platform, users gain the agility needed to support changing business demands and opportunities, while having clear visibility into who is using APIs for better control, security and monetization of digital assets.
